Product Description

Structural Features

This CNC machine features a monolithic cartridge-type spindle unit designed for high rigidity, high precision, and heavy-duty machining. The spindle is supported by imported precision bearings in a '3+2' (front-triple, rear-double) layout, driven by a high-performance spindle servo system. This configuration ensures exceptional rotational accuracy, superior rigidity, and high load capacity during high-speed operations. The bed structure utilizes an integrated premium cast iron base with a 30° slant-bed design. Crafted using resin-sand casting and a reinforced rib-and-plate internal structure, it offers outstanding structural rigidity and vibration damping, while simultaneously optimizing operator ergonomics and chip evacuation paths.

X and Z axes feature high-rigidity precision linear guideways paired with pre-tensioned ball screws, which are directly coupled to the servo motors via flexible couplings. To ensure sustained accuracy, the system is equipped with an intelligent automatic lubrication system that provides continuous forced lubrication to the rails and screws. This configuration achieves superior positioning precision, minimizes thermal deformation, and enables rapid traverse rates of up to 30 m/min.

Hydraulic station is equipped with premium Taiwanese variable displacement pumps, hydraulic motors, and solenoid valves, integrated with a high-efficiency air-cooled heat exchanger to ensure low noise levels and stable oil temperatures. The machine offers a choice of hydraulic or servo rotary turrets, both featuring exceptional rigidity and rapid indexing. Supporting bi-directional shortest-path tool selection, the system achieves a lightning-fast tool-to-tool time of 0.3–0.5 seconds, making it ideally suited for the heavy-duty machining of disk-type components.

Hydraulic-controlled tailstock features a fully programmable/automatic quill, ensuring a robust structure and effortless operation. This configuration significantly expands the machine's capability for processing long-shaft workpieces while maintaining superior stability.

The machine is equipped with an aesthetically pleasing, fully enclosed guarding system that provides superior coolant and chip containment. The sliding doors are designed for effortless operation and are integrated with safety interlocking devices, ensuring an optimal balance between operator protection and convenience.

Technical Specifications
Item Unit NXX-46D NXX-52D
Max. Swing Over Bed mm Φ450 Φ450
Max. Machining Length mm 500 500
Max. Swing Over Cross Slide (Carriage) mm Φ220 Φ220
Max. Workpiece Dia. (Disk / Shaft) mm Φ450/Φ220 Φ450/Φ220
Spindle Bore Diameter mm Φ56 Φ62
Max. Bar Capacity mm Φ45 Φ51
Spindle Speed Range r/min 0-4000 0-3000
Spindle Speed Steps (Stepless for Servo) Step CV CV
Spindle Nose Type Flange Type A2-5 Flange Type A2-5
Main Motor Power Kw 7.5 11
Bed Slant Angle Angle 30° 30°
X-axis Rapid Traverse Rate m/min 30 30
Z-axis Rapid Traverse Rate m/min 30 30
Max. X-axis Travel (Single Direction) mm 500 500
Max. Z-axis Travel mm 550 550
X/Z Axis Servo Motor Power mm 1.3 1.3
Tailstock Quill Diameter mm Φ80 Φ80
Tailstock Quill Travel mm 80 80
Tailstock Spindle Taper (MT) MT 4 5
Tailstock Body Travel mm 480 480
Spindle Radial & Axial Run-out Accuracy mm ≤0.003 ≤0.003
Spindle Face Flatness Accuracy mm ≤0.01/Φ100 ≤0.01/Φ100
Repeatability Accuracy X-axis mm ±0.0025 ±0.0025
Z-axis mm ±0.0025 ±0.0025
Standard Turret Type 160-10 Station Hydraulic Indexing Turret 160-10 Station Hydraulic Indexing Turret
Number of Tool Stations (Max.) pcs 10 10
Tool-to-Tool Indexing Time (Adjacent) S 0.5 0.5
Tool Size O.D. Tool mm 25×25 25×25
Boring Bar Diameter mm Φ32 Φ32
Total Power Consumption Kw 11 14.5
Machine Weight (Approx.) kg 3300 3500
Overall Dimensions (L×W×H) mm 2700×1810×1880 2700×1810×1880
